Future Bass was mastered at Transition studios in South East London, and will be available on super-loud, super-heavyweight triple-vinyl.
The CD version will come in deluxe plastic casing, complete with a set of limited edition postcards.
According to a press release, the compilation will be followed a series of 12-inches featuring more exclusive tracks by the artists included, the first of which will come from Hemlock Recordings boss Untold.
